Apricot Pistachio Cookies Recipe

Ingredients

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up dried apricots, finely chopped
  • 1/2 cup pistachios, shelled and chopped
  • Zest of 1 orange (optional for a citrusy twist)
  • Powdered sugar for dusting (optional)

Substitutions

  • Flour: Use almond flour for a gluten-free option.
  • Sugar: Brown sugar can be used for a deeper flavor.
  • Butter: For a vegan version, use plant-based butter.
  • Egg: Substitute with 1/4 cup of applesauce for an egg-free variant.

Instructions

  1. Preparation: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
  3. Creaming: In a large bowl, beat the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add the egg and vanilla extract, continuing to beat until well incorporated.
  4. Combining: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ing until just combined. Fold in the chopped apricots, pistachios, and orange zest (if using).
  5. Shaping: Roll the dough into small balls, about 1 tablespoon each, and place them on the prepared baking sheet. Flatten them slightly with the back of a spoon or your fingers.
  6. Baking: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den.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
  7. Finishing Touch: Once cooled, dust the cookies with powdered sugar for a festive look.

Special Tips

  • For a richer flavor, toast the pistachios lightly before chopping.
  • Ensure the apricots are finely chopped to distribute their flavor evenly.
  • Do not overmix the dough to keep the cookies tender.

This recipe makes approximately 24 cookies, ensuring there’s plenty to share with loved ones during this special time of year. Enjoy the magic of Christmas with every bite! 🎄🍪🌟
